The local taxis around here (Windsor/Maidenhead) would charge you about £20 to £25 (total, not pp) for a pickup at Heathrow to Windsor. Some of them could handle 6 of you, as long as didn't have much in the way of luggage. If you are all carrying some kind of luggage, you'd need two cabs, so double the rate. As BTilke says, a local taxi would be able to accomodate you unless you are schlepping all of your luggage. If this is for a layover between flights,there are left luggage facilities at LHR.

If, on the other hand, you are staying over in Windsor, you would do well to pre-book a car service and they will use a mini-van type vehicle w/ space for you and your bags. Even a van will only be 20-30GBP total (not perperson).

Or of course - you can always take the local bus for a few GBP per person.
